Similar to Apple’s widely praised AirTags, the Pebblebee Clip uses the very same Find My network to help locate your lost stuff: keys, bags, suitcases and so on.
However, the Clip can alternately pair with an Android phone instead, leveraging Google’s Find My Device network in like fashion.
It’s rechargeable, too, meaning you won’t need to replace the battery every year. And it has flashing LEDs to further help you find your missing item.
